Output 176df609c8a2178e8bb328ff18e6d2503930b09891d83a8444ae2333c4c50aa4:1

value
93845
script pubkey
OP_0 OP_PUSHBYTES_32 bac389bd37fc71f94b690b4e567adf049a10b36d0198deda794952eb11222654
address
bc1qhtpcn0fhl3cljjmfpd89v7klqjdppvmdqxvdaknef9fwkyfzye2qx949x3
transaction
176df609c8a2178e8bb328ff18e6d2503930b09891d83a8444ae2333c4c50aa4
confirmations
179
spent
true